Output 4caea1e59ddcee053ae562404cccfd4ec48a8441c2424d65dc1a99a27e000a31:5

value
22487
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 09fbb8733abd98f2011c899caf13de9af351369b5ef953bb4aa979758ad54d3f
address
tb1pp8amsue6hkv0yqgu3xw27y77nte4zd5mtmu48w6249uhtzk4f5lsemq5gx
transaction
4caea1e59ddcee053ae562404cccfd4ec48a8441c2424d65dc1a99a27e000a31
confirmations
67484
spent
true